1.Executive summary
Making sure that the work is being done according to the plan is the
responsibility of the project management activity known as the controlling process.
Compare the project's timing to the projected timetable and keep an eye on the
resources available to verify that the team has everything needed to finish the project
effectively. The method for calculating a project's network and drawing the critical
path is described in the following paragraphs.
2. Introduction
In actuality, projects might be quite complex, yet they all follow the same
project management methodology. Project managers frequently face difficult
obstacles that could compromise a project's success. Keeping up with the project's
pace, managing resources, and making sure it is on track and within the required
budget are some of the usual issues that keep them on their toes.

5. Conclusion
Deadlines for the projects exist. We must always consider how to manage
limited time-based resources while dealing with deadlines. Our direct control over
such circumstances is not possible. But improvising and adapting are the best course
of action. Understanding how multiple constraints must be balanced in order to
achieve the project's objective is essential.
